Delimitation Comm meets today

Excelsior Correspondent
JAMMU, June 29: The Delimitation Commission tasked with redrawing Parliamentary and Assembly constituencies in Jammu and Kashmir is likely to hold an internal meeting on Wednesday in New Delhi to finalise its plans on consultations with political parties soon.
The three-member Delimitation Commission headed by former Supreme Court Judge Ranjana Desai was appointed in February last year. It could not complete its work within the allotted time of one year and has now been given an extension of one year.
A full meeting of the Commission including its associate members such as Lok Sabha MPs from Jammu and Kashmir is likely to take place soon. The date for such a meeting will be firmed up on Wednesday.
